Safer Internet Day 2022

We joined schools and youth organisations across the UK in celebrating Safer Internet Day on the 8th February 2022. Safer Internet Day is a global campaign to promote the safe and responsible use of technology, which calls on young people, parents, carers, teachers, social workers, law enforcement, companies, policymakers and more, to join together in helping to create a better internet.

Using the internet safely and positively is a key message that we promote at Rounds Green Primary School, and celebrating Safer Internet Day throughout the week was a great opportunity for us to re-emphasise the online safety messages we deliver throughout the year.

The theme of Safer Internet Day was ‘All fun and games? Exploring respect and relationships online’.
